The iconic rapper Kanye West made waves in the music industry with his album, “Graduation”, dropping in September 2007. The project defined a significant shift in Kanye’s artistic journey, blending groundbreaking rhythms with electronic influences.
Graduation contained numerous unforgettable hits, including “Stronger”, which dominated the charts. Other standout tracks like “Good Life” and the heartfelt “Homecoming” helped define its legacy.
The visual identity of the album was equally iconic. Japanese artist Takashi Murakami was brought in to design the album’s visuals, showcasing his signature look is clearly evident. Posters inspired by the album mirror this vision, featuring a bold palette, fantastical designs, and Kanye’s bear mascot ascending into the sky.
